Catherine Rhatigan, Eileen Carr and Treasa Ni Mhiollain return to the Ancient Music Festival of Dorlindon this year with a delightful new programme.
The repertoire features music and songs from the Irish tradition dedicated to forests and forest animals and birds. There are many of them, often overlooked, many beautiful and simple, and some of course, quite complex.
The trio will also play music and songs composed about women in older Irish society.
The performance brings together traditional songs and tunes inspired by the cornerstones of everyday life in Ireland in times gone past; nature, women, and animals, music and song!
Treasa, has also promised to teach us all a simple song in Irish for anyone who wants to learn one, so you have a musical memory to take home from your magical afternoon in Dorlindon Forest.
